I cut my previous weld out and stretched the frame back to where it should be, pated the inside where it broke, welded in a cross tube, and tied the shock mount gusset into the new tube. It stiffened the frame substantially. I don't feel I'll have to worry about it again. Now time to find the next weakest link.

That welded in shock scares me. You should at least weld shock tabs off of the tube.

Mounting it like that is putting alot of force on the edge of the frame, and those will tear out with enough force. I remember you already seeing the results of that on the frame once. Dont forget to strap the rear, those are very cheap insurance, and you really shouldn't jump without them.


this is the only pic i could find of what i mean. welded to the frame may work, but its single sheer and bro fab if you ask me.
